/*				Realizzazione Net.Service S.r.l.				  */
/*  			http://www.net-serv.it							  */
/*  ------------------------------------------------------------  */
#corpo 
{
	background-color:#FFFFFF;
	/*width: 100%;*/
	margin:0px auto 0px auto;
	/*position: relative;*/
	padding:0px 0px 0px 0px;
	text-align:center;
	/*clear:left;			*/
}
.c100{ width:100%;}
.c50{ width:49%;  float:left; text-align:left; }
.c33{ width:33%;  float:left; text-align:left; }
.c25{ width:24%;  float:left; text-align:left; }

/* colore link in comune sulle colonne cx e dx */
#ColCX a,#ColDX a{
	color:#001B75;
	text-decoration:underline;		
	}
#ColCX a:hover,#ColDX a:hover{
	text-decoration:none;
}	

/* colonna centrale */

#ColCX
{			
	z-index: 1;	
	text-align:left;
}
#ColCX h1 {	
	background:#d6d6c7 url("img/ico-h1.gif") no-repeat 0px 0px;
	font-size:1.2em;
	color:#333;
	padding:3px 0px 6px 25px;
	margin:0px 0px 0px 0px;
	height: auto !important;	
	height:0px;
}
#ColCX h2 {
	font-size:1.1em;
	background:#D8EDFE;	
	color:#333;
	text-align:center;
	padding:2px 0px 2px 0px;
	margin:4px 0px 4px 0px;
	height: auto !important;	
	height:0px;
}
#ColCX h3 {
	font-size:1.0em;
	background:#EEF7FA;	
	color:#333;
	text-align:center;
	padding:2px 0px 2px 0px;
	margin:4px 0px 4px 0px;
	height: auto !important;	
	height:0px;
}
#ColCX p
{
	color:#555;
	font-size:0.84em;		
	margin:10px 0px 10px 0px;
}
#ColCX ol, #ColCX ul
{
	color:#333;
	font-size:0.8em;			
}

#ColCX ol li a
{
	
}

#ColCX li li
{
	color:#333;		
	margin-left:0px;
}
#ColCX li li li 
{
	color:#333;
	font-size:1em;		
	margin-left:0px;
}
#ColCX ol ol, #ColCX ul ul
{
	font-size:1em;		
}

#ColCX .left{ text-align:left; margin:0px; padding:0px 0px 0px 0px;}
#ColCX .left img{ float:left; margin:0px 6px 0px 0px; padding:2px;clear:left;border:1px solid #e0e0e0;}
#ColCX .right{ text-align:right; margin:6px; padding:0px 0px 0px 0px;}
#ColCX .right img{ float:right; margin:0px 0px 0px 6px; padding:2px;clear:right;border:1px solid #e0e0e0;}
#ColCX .center{ text-align:center;}

.SiteMap ul, .SiteMap_Root {
	list-style:none;
}

#ColCX table {
  width: 100%;
  margin:0; 
  padding:0;
  font-size:0.8em;  
}
#ColCX table, #ColCX tr, #ColCX th, #ColCX td {
border-collapse: collapse;
vertical-align:top;
}
#ColCX caption {
  margin:0; 
  padding:0;
  background: #FFFF66;
  height: 33px;
  line-height: 33px;
  text-align: left;
  border-style: none none solid none; 
  border-width: thin;
  padding: 2px;
}

/* HEAD */

#ColCX thead {
  background-color: #FFFFFF;
  border: none;
}
#ColCX thead tr th {
  height: 78px;
  font-size: 15px ;
  line-height: 78px;
  text-align: center;
  background-repeat: repeat-x;  
  border-collapse: collapse;
}

/* BODY */

#ColCX tbody tr {
  background: #EEF6FC;
}

#ColCX tbody tr:hover  {
  background: #FFF;  
}
#ColCX tbody tr th, #ColCX tbody tr td {
  padding: 6px;
  border: solid 1px #aaa;
}
#ColCX tbody tr th {
  background: #FFF;
  padding: 6px;
  text-align: center;
  font-weight: bold;  
  border-bottom: solid 1px #000;
}
#ColCX tbody tr th:hover {
  background: #FFF;
}

/* LINKS */

#ColCX table a {
  color: blue;
}
#ColCX table a:visited {
  color: purple ; 
}
#ColCX table a:active {
  color: red ; 
}

/* FOOTER */

#ColCX tfoot {
  height: 24px;
  line-height: 24px;
  color: #000;
  text-align: center;
}
#ColCX tfoot tr td {
  color: blue;
}


#ColCX fieldset{ 
	width:90%;
	margin:0px auto;
	margin-bottom:20px;
	border:1px solid #D6D6D6;
	margin-top:20px;
}
#ColCX fieldset legend {
	background:transparent url(img_gallery/desc.png) no-repeat 5px 6px;
	border:1px solid #D6D6D6;
	color:#003366;
	font-size:small;
	font-weight:bold;
	margin-left:4px;
	padding:2px 12px 4px 24px;
}
/* mappa */
.SiteMap ul, .SiteMap_Root {
list-style-image:none;
list-style-position:outside;
list-style-type:none;
}
.SiteMap #MapRoot {
background:transparent url("img_mappa/world.gif") no-repeat 0px 2px;
font-size:1.4em;
padding-left:20px;
}
.SiteMap ul li {
padding:10px 0px 4px 0px;
}
.SiteMap ul li.homepage {
background:transparent url("img_mappa/l0.gif") no-repeat 0px 10px;
padding-left:20px;
}
.SiteMap ul li.pagine {
background:transparent url("img_mappa/zero.gif") no-repeat 0px 10px;
padding-left:20px;
}
.SiteMap ul li.doc {
background:transparent url("img_mappa/l1.gif") no-repeat 0px 10px;
padding-left:20px;
}
.SiteMap ul li.news {
background:transparent url("img_mappa/newspaper.gif") no-repeat 0px 10px;
padding-left:20px;
}
.SiteMap ul li.immagini {
background:transparent url("img_mappa/image_sunset.gif") no-repeat 0px 10px;
padding-left:20px;
}
.SiteMap ul li.comunicati {
background:transparent url("img_mappa/comunicati.gif") no-repeat 0px 10px;
padding-left:20px;
}
.SiteMap ul li.eventi {
background:transparent url("img_mappa/star.gif") no-repeat 0px 10px;
padding-left:20px;
}
.SiteMap ul li.bandi {
background:transparent url("img_mappa/hammer.gif") no-repeat 0px 10px;
padding-left:20px;
}
.SiteMap ul li.faq {
background:transparent url("img_mappa/faq.gif") no-repeat 0px 10px;
padding-left:20px;
}
.SiteMap ul li.link {
background:transparent url("img_mappa/link.gif") no-repeat 0px 10px;
padding-left:20px;
}
.SiteMap ul li.questionari {
background:transparent url("img_mappa/questionari.gif") no-repeat 0px 10px;
padding-left:20px;
}
.SiteMap ul li.modulistica {
background:transparent url("img_mappa/modulistica.gif") no-repeat 0px 10px;
padding-left:20px;
}

#ColCX .nodeDesc {
	display:none;
}
